This is the main sign for the Labyrinth of Peace with its invitation to people of all faith traditions to Journey in light, Journey in Hope, Journey in Peace.

324 MacDonald St. West
Moose Jaw
Saskatchewan, S6H 2V4
Canada

View Map View Map

The Labyrinth of Peace is on the front grounds of Vanier Collegiate high school. It is the only labyrinth of its kind in the world. It is an original pathway design in a garden-like setting. It has 11 unique sites created by local artisans. It has original music and meditations for a guided relaxation experience. All can be downloaded free from our website or people can simply walk the pathway in this garden-like setting.
